An Introduction to Diversifying the Curriculum with Orlene Badu
Monday, May 23, 2022 @ 4:00 pm - 5:30 pm
The curriculum is a vehicle for systemic change in our schools and beyond. The journey of creating a curriculum that ensures every child feels valued, reflected and celebrated is an in-depth journey, to ensure we do it well. It requires a deep understanding how to ensure the right context to support staff in creating a curriculum in which every child has a sense of belonging.
What you will learn on this session:
- How to use your curriculum to develop Anti-Racist Leaders of the Future.
- Begin to identify the gaps that may exist in your current curriculum to support a roadmap to how to ensure diversity across your curriculum.
- Identify the strands that will ensure a diverse curriculum.
- Understand that ‘decolonising’ the curriculum is not the removal of anything.
- Understand how to work within the limitations of our current curriculum to create a curriculum that celebrates the contributions that all communities made to the UK.
- Be clear how to ensure how intersectionality can be evidenced in your curriculum.
This session will be led by Orlene Badu, leadership consultant. Orlene is a curriculum enthusiast and supports school and subject leaders to create a diverse curriculum that inspires and enthuses.
